Why tinned? Because it stops oxidation. If you use bare copper in a humid or oily factory, it will turn green and fail. The tin coating keeps the connection strong for years. The insulation is a special PVC or TPE mix that stays soft even in cold temperatures. It does not get stiff like cheap plastic.The structure is 24AWG*6P. This means you have 6 pairs of twisted wires. Twisting the wires is the secret weapon. It cancels out noise. If you run this cable next to a big power line or a VFD (Variable Frequency Drive), the twisted pairs protect your data signals. The shield around the pairs acts as a guard. It catches outside interference and sends it to the ground. This ensures your data transmission is clean and error-free.
Technical Specs That Matter
We believe in being honest about what our cables can do. Here are the real numbers you need to know to see if this fits your project:
- Conductor: Tinned Copper (High conductivity, anti-oxidation)
- Conductor Size: 24AWG (0.2mm² / 0.3mm² option available)
- Core Count: 12 Cores (arranged as 6 pairs)
- Structure: Shielded Twisted Pair (STP)
- Shield Material: Copper Braid (90% coverage for EMI protection)
- Insulation: Special Flexible PVC or TPE
- Sheath: PVC or PUR (Oil and UV resistant)
- Rated Voltage: 300V / 500V
- Bending Radius: 8x to 10x Cable Diameter (Dynamic)
- Tensile Strength: Anti-pull (Internal strength member options available)
- Temperature Range: -20°C to +80°C (PUR versions go higher)
- Cycle Life: Over 5 million bending cycles (at fixed radius)
- Color: Black (Custom colors like Green, Orange, Blue available)
